FDMT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review

120 of the 7,595 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in 4D Molecular Therapeutics (FDMT)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$151M — up 7.2% from $141M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 22 funds closed out of FDMT and 17 opened new positions — a net loss of 5 holders — while 40 trimmed existing stakes and 43 added.

The largest buyer was Federated Hermes, adding an estimated $1.47M. The largest seller was Redmile Group, cutting an estimated $3.11M.
